WebMar 11, 2012 · Health. Health was one of the greatest differences between ancient and modern times. As late as England in the 18 th century, twenty-five women died for every 1000 babies born. According to estimates using data from the Roman Empire, about three hundred of every 1000 newborns died before completing their first year.
